What advice do you have for prospective blueAPACHE candidates?

Don’t be afraid to follow up your application. I work part-time and am not always able to get through everything during the week. I like proactive candidates who demonstrate their enthusiasm for the role. It sets you apart from others and I always make time to speak with you.

Also, be aware that you are being assessed throughout the recruitment process, not just during interviews. It is important to be on time, return phone calls and maintain a professional conduct throughout the process.
